在计算机系统中,root权限是最高级别的权限,拥有该权限的用户可以对系统进行完全控制。然而,过多使用root权限可能会引发潜在的安全风险,如恶意软件的入侵、敏感数据的泄露等。为了保护系统的安全性,关闭root权限是非常重要的一步。本文将介绍如何安全关闭root权限,以保障系统的稳定和安全。

1.确定是否有其他可信任的管理员账户

在关闭root权限之前,确保系统中有其他可信任的管理员账户可以使用,以免关闭后无法进行必要的系统操作。

2.修改sudoers文件

使用root权限登录系统后,通过修改sudoers文件来限制其他用户对root权限的访问。可以通过命令"sudovisudo"来编辑sudoers文件。

3.增加其他管理员账户

创建一个新的管理员账户,并将其添加到sudoers文件中,以便该账户可以执行需要root权限的操作。

4.禁用root账户登录

通过修改系统配置文件,禁用root账户的登录功能。这样即使知道root账户的密码,也无法直接登录进入系统。

5.配置su命令

修改su命令的配置文件,限制只有特定的管理员账户可以使用该命令切换到root权限。

6.设置密码策略

使用复杂的密码,并定期更改root账户的密码,以增加系统的安全性。

7.使用sudo命令管理权限

将需要进行root操作的命令添加到sudoers文件中,并给予其他管理员账户使用sudo命令的权限,以代替直接使用root权限。

8.定期监测系统安全性

使用安全监测工具定期扫描系统,确保没有异常活动或潜在威胁。

9.限制用户权限

将系统用户的权限分级,根据实际需求授予不同级别的权限,避免不必要的风险。

10.定期备份系统数据

定期备份系统数据,以防止意外情况发生时造成数据丢失,并将备份文件存放在安全可靠的地方。

11.使用安全更新和补丁

及时安装系统和应用程序的安全更新和补丁,以修复已知的漏洞和弱点。

12.安装防火墙和入侵检测系统

配置防火墙和入侵检测系统,以监控和阻止恶意行为和网络攻击。

13.教育用户意识

培养用户对系统安全的意识,教育他们在使用系统时避免点击可疑链接、下载未知软件等不安全行为。

14.定期审查权限设置

定期审查系统中各个用户的权限设置,确保权限分配的合理性和安全性。

15.监控系统日志

定期检查系统日志,及时发现异常行为并采取相应措施,以保证系统的安全性。

关闭root权限是保护系统免受潜在威胁的重要步骤之一。通过修改sudoers文件、禁用root账户登录、配置su命令等措施,可以有效限制对root权限的访问。同时,定期备份数据、更新补丁、安装防火墙等措施也是确保系统安全的重要手段。教育用户意识和定期审查权限设置也不可忽视。只有综合使用这些措施,才能有效提升系统的安全性,避免潜在威胁的发生。